Instructions to make Simple Mutton Curry:
Wash mutton pieces in running water.Keep aside to drain.
Now marinate mutton pieces with turmeric powder,cumin powder,coriander powder,red chilli powder,yoghurt and salt.Mix well using your hands,rubbing the spices into the meat.Marinate for 30 minutes.
Now take a heavy-bottomed pan and heat.Add oil and ghee.When smoke starts coming out of it,add the whole spices and bay leaves for tempering.Add a pinch of sugar.It gives an amazing colour to mutton.
Add the chopped onions and cook on low flame for 10 minutes.
When the onions turn translucent,reduce the heat and stir until they turn light brown.
Now add in the marinated mutton,ginger paste and garlic paste and cook on high flame for 5-7 minutes,stirring continuously.
Cover the lid of the vessel,lower the flame and allow it to simmer until the mutton is completely cooked.Check once or twice to see that the mutton isn't sticking to the bottom of the vessel.
When done open the lid and cook till oil starts separating from the meat.
Add a cup of water and stir well.When it comes to a boil add in garam masala powder.Mix well.
Cook uncovered till oil floats on top.
Transfer the mutton curry into a bowl.
Serve hot with steamed rice.
